+/** @file
+ *
+ * Distributed under <a href="http://www.gnu.org/licenses/gpl2.txt";>GNU/GPL</a>
+ *
+ * This file contains functionality to support a subset of <a
+ * href="http://tools.ietf.org/html/draft-ietf-hip-native-api";> Native
+ * HIP API</a> resolver functionality. The implemented functionality
+ * may be not be completely up-to-date with the specification.
+ *
+ * Functionality beyond the native HIP API is also implemented here,
+ * such as application-specific host identities as described in <a
+ * href="http://www.niksula.cs.hut.fi/~mkomu/docs/f17-komu.pdf";>M. Komu,
+ * S. Tarkoma, J. Kangasharju, A. Gurtov, Applying a Cryptographic
+ * Namespace to Applications, in Proc. of First International ACM
+ * Workshop on Dynamic Interconnection of Networks, September
+ * 2005. </a>.
+ *
+ * You can find test software for the native API in test directory
+ * (all of them have the word "native" in their file name). The use of
+ * the native API requires a small patch to the kernel (from the
+ * patches directory) and a kernel module to be loaded from the
+ * hipsock directory.
+ *
+ * It should be noted that this file can be erased completely if
+ * the support for native HIP API will be ceased.
+ *
+ * @author Miika Komu <miika@xxxxxx>
+ * @author Anthony D. Joseph <adj@xxxxxxx>
+ *
+ * @brief <a href="http://tools.ietf.org/html/draft-ietf-hip-native-api";>
+ *        Native HIP API</a> functionality
